50.1% of the people in Burnet County are religious:
- 16.2% are Baptist
- 1.0% are Episcopalian
- 11.1% are Catholic
- 2.0% are Lutheran
- 5.6% are Methodist
- 0.8% are Pentecostal
- 1.2% are Presbyterian
- 1.7%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 10.4% are another Christian faith
- 0.0% are Judaism
- 0.0% are an eastern faith
- 0.0% affilitates with Islam
